MYRON McKINLEY, the musical director of the legendary Earth, Wind and Fire, will be one of the musicians on keyboards at the eighth annual FirstCaribbean Christmas Jazz on Sunday, December 12, and Monday, December 13, at the Plantation Garden Theatre.
McKinley, a multi-talented and gifted pianist, was born and raised in Los Angeles and began jazz and classical piano at the tender age of three years old.
He graduated with a Bachelor of Music degree from the University of Southern California where he studied film scoring, performance, jazz and classical piano. During his stint at university he was the recipient of several awards.  
Quickly after graduating he performed and toured with a number of music’s biggest artists including Stevie Wonder, Whitney Houston, Morris Day, CeCe Winans, Faith Evans, Patti LaBelle, to name a few.
